REVIEW

Once upon a time, there was a girl named Lucy who was not “fine” no matter how many times she said it. She lost her mom to cancer, and for a short time, she lost her father to sadness. Because she has six younger brothers, she knew she needed to take care of them and help them live each day, but there was no one there to help her…to take care of her…until him. Cameron came at a time in her life when she was merely surviving, and he healed her, made her feel alive, made her want things that she didn’t think she could have. But Cameron’s strength and love for Lucy made her believe that she…that they…could have their forever. But when you fall in love at 15 years old, there’s still a lot of life to be lived…a lot of growing up and changes to be experienced, but that didn’t faze Lucy and Cameron. Their love for each other knows no bounds, but life sometimes does get in the way, and insecurities and stress can alter any relationship, even one as solid as theirs. A promise of forever – that’s what Cameron and Lucy gave each other at the tender age of 15, and that’s what they’ll do their best to hold on to even when there’s doubts…even when actions say otherwise.

Because their story spans almost a decade, Lucy and Cameron’s relationship goes through a gamut of emotions and events. Their tale is one of loss, sacrifice, heartbreak, and sadness, but it’s also a journey of firsts, defining moments, and a copious amount of hope.

One of Jay McLean’s talents as a writer is her ability to create a cast of characters that literally come alive through her words. They are complex, dynamic heroes and heroines who readers grow to love and respect as we watch them endure all of the trials and tribulations that are brought their way.

Lucy is an amazing heroine. She’s feisty, humorous, intelligent, and willing to give her all for those she loves. She has amazing strength but at the same time is quite fragile due to everything she’s been through in her short life. I love how obsessed with reading Lucy is; she’s a girl after my own heart. It makes sense that she wants to lose herself in fictional plots because she needs that escape…a break from her life. Despite all of the hardships, Lucy’s light still shines with Cameron’s help, which makes her my favorite heroine of the More series.

Cameron – how swoonworthy is he? He wears his heart on his sleeve, and he would help heal the world if he could. He’s Lucy’s everything…her forever, and that is his most important job. Does he have “guy” moments? Absolutely. But through all of the chaos, he remains 100 % committed to Lucy, and no one could ask for more.

The supporting characters in the More series are just as important as the main ones. Cam and Luce’s circle of friends share an amazing bond that anyone would kill to have. They know they can rely on one another no matter the circumstances and that is clearly illustrated in More Than Forever as well as the previous three books. And then there’s the parents…they’re amazing. I didn’t think anyone could match up to Logan’s father, and then Jay introduces readers to Mark – Cam’s step dad. How he steps up for Cam throughout the entire book is breathtaking. He gives of himself without expecting anything in return, which makes sense that Cam is the exact same way.

More Than Forever may not be a fairy tale because all of the pain Lucy and Cam endure can only be found in reality, but it is a story of fate…a story of the kind of love that everyone aspires to have…a story of the forever kind! Team Luca all the way!

EXCERPT

I see her wobble on her feet before she slowly tumbles 


to the ground. Her knees give out first, then the rest of 


her. It feels like I should’ve gotten to her earlier, but 


seconds of panic took place before my mind kicked into 


gear. And the rest is a blur.


Her friend’s standing over us while I rest her head on 


my lap. “Lucy,” I say. And it’s the first time I’ve said 


her name out loud. It’d been over three weeks since I’d 


learned it.


“What happened?” Logan asks her friend.


“I don’t know.” She’s as panicked as I am, if not 


worse.


“Is she dehydrated?” Logan picks up what looks like an 


uneaten sandwich. “Is this hers? Has she eaten?” I don’t 


know why it annoys me that Logan is asking all the right 


questions and all I can do is stare down at her. She’s 


breathing, so I guess that’s something.


He drops down on his knees on the other side of her and 


pours water from his bottle into his hand, and then he 


runs it across her forehead and into her hairline.


“Is she alright, mate?” Jake asks. He’s new and has a 


weird accent but Logan seems to think he’s cool so we 


keep him around.


Logan does the water thing again, and this time her 


eyes slowly flutter open.


And I release the breath I was holding.


“It’s okay,” Logan says to her, “you just passed out.” 


He’s in her face now, and I want to punch him for being 


the first thing she sees when she comes to. I was here 


first; I was the one watching her when she fell. It 


should have been me.

AUTHOR BIO
Jay McLean is the author of the More Series, including More Than This, More Than Her, More Than Him and soon to be released, More Than Forever. She also has two standalones coming soon titled The Road, and Combative.Jay is an avid reader, writer, and most of all, procrastinator. When she’s not doing any of those things, she can be found running after her two little boys, or devouring some tacky reality TV show.
She writes what she loves to read, which are books that can make her laugh, make her smile, make her hurt, and make her feel.
